Performance and use

X5CrNi189 metal powder injection

Yield strength σs=263.80 MPa

Tensile strength σb=625.55 Mpa

Elongation δ=46.70%

Hardness HB ≤187 HRB≤90 HV ≤200

Young's modulus E=194020 MPa

Hardening index n=0.193

Thick anisotropy index r00=0.936 r45=1.123 r90=0.909

Density ρ=7.93 g cm-3

Specific heat c(20℃)0.502 J·(g·C)-1

Thermal conductivity λ/W(m·℃)-1 (at the following temperature/℃) 20 100 500 2.1 16.3 21.4

Linear expansion coefficient α/(10-6/℃) (between the following temperatures/℃) 20~100 20~200 20~300 20~400 16.0 16.8 17.5 18.1

Resistivity 0.73 Ω·mm2·m-1

Melting point 1398~1420℃

Household goods, cabinets, indoor pipelines, water heaters, boilers, bathtubs, auto parts, medical appliances, building materials, chemicals, food industry, agriculture, ship parts. the

SUS304 heat treatment specification: solid solution 1010 ~ 1150 ℃ rapid cooling.

Metallographic structure: The structure is characterized by austenitic type. the

SUS304 is 18/8 stainless steel.

The GB grade is 0Cr18Ni9. the

US304 is a Japanese JIS standard material and is a Japanese SUS series austenitic stainless steel. Equivalent to 0Cr18Ni9 in my country and 304 in the United States
